package im.vector.matrix.android.internal.session.room.send
import android.content.Context
import androidx.work.CoroutineWorker
import androidx.work.WorkerParameters
import com.squareup.moshi.JsonClass
import im.vector.matrix.android.api.failure.Failure
import im.vector.matrix.android.api.session.crypto.CryptoService
import im.vector.matrix.android.api.session.events.model.Event
import im.vector.matrix.android.api.session.room.send.SendState
import im.vector.matrix.android.internal.crypto.model.MXEncryptEventContentResult
import im.vector.matrix.android.internal.util.awaitCallback
import im.vector.matrix.android.internal.worker.SessionWorkerParams
import im.vector.matrix.android.internal.worker.WorkerParamsFactory
import im.vector.matrix.android.internal.worker.getSessionComponent
import timber.log.Timber
import javax.inject.Inject
internal class EncryptEventWorker(context: Context, params: WorkerParameters)
: CoroutineWorker(context, params) {
@JsonClass(generateAdapter = true)
internal data class Params(
override val userId: String,
val roomId: String,
val event: Event,
/**Do not encrypt these keys, keep them as is in encrypted content (e.g. m.relates_to)*/
val keepKeys: List<String>? = null,
override val lastFailureMessage: String? = null
) : SessionWorkerParams
@Inject lateinit var crypto: CryptoService
@Inject lateinit var localEchoUpdater: LocalEchoUpdater
override suspend fun doWork(): Result {
Timber.v("Start Encrypt work")
val params = WorkerParamsFactory.fromData<Params>(inputData)
?: return Result.success().also {
Timber.v("Work cancelled due to input error from parent")
}
Timber.v("Start Encrypt work for event ${params.event.eventId}")
if (params.lastFailureMessage != null) {
// Transmit the error
return Result.success(inputData)
}
val sessionComponent = getSessionComponent(params.userId) ?: return Result.success()
sessionComponent.inject(this)
val localEvent = params.event
if (localEvent.eventId == null) {
return Result.success()
}
localEchoUpdater.updateSendState(localEvent.eventId, SendState.ENCRYPTING)
val localMutableContent = HashMap(localEvent.content)
params.keepKeys?.forEach {
localMutableContent.remove(it)
}
var error: Throwable? = null
var result: MXEncryptEventContentResult? = null
try {
result = awaitCallback {
crypto.encryptEventContent(localMutableContent, localEvent.type, params.roomId, it)
}
} catch (throwable: Throwable) {
error = throwable
}
if (result != null) {
val modifiedContent = HashMap(result.eventContent)
params.keepKeys?.forEach { toKeep ->
localEvent.content?.get(toKeep)?.let {
//put it back in the encrypted thing
modifiedContent[toKeep] = it
}
}
val safeResult = result.copy(eventContent = modifiedContent)
val encryptedEvent = localEvent.copy(
type = safeResult.eventType,
content = safeResult.eventContent
)
val nextWorkerParams = SendEventWorker.Params(params.userId, params.roomId, encryptedEvent)
return Result.success(WorkerParamsFactory.toData(nextWorkerParams))
} else {
val sendState = when (error) {
is Failure.CryptoError -> SendState.FAILED_UNKNOWN_DEVICES
else -> SendState.UNDELIVERED
}
localEchoUpdater.updateSendState(localEvent.eventId, sendState)
//always return success, or the chain will be stuck for ever!
val nextWorkerParams = SendEventWorker.Params(params.userId, params.roomId, localEvent, error?.localizedMessage
?: "Error")
return Result.success(WorkerParamsFactory.toData(nextWorkerParams))
}
}
}
